Mocking Eligibility Checks

In our Staging/Sandbox environment, we connect to Stedi’s Test API to run eligibility checks.

We have created a set of mock requests that can be used to verify the behavior of the system. These requests are based on Stedi’s Test API own mock request documentation and are designed to cover various scenarios.

To get a mock eligibility check response, you can use the following request body:

Aetna with dependent
1{
2 "payer_id": "60054",
3 "provider": {
4 "organization_name": "Provider Name",
5 "npi": "1999999984"
6 },
7 "subscriber": {
8 "first_name": "John",
9 "last_name": "Doe",
10 "member_id": "AETNA9wcSu",
11 "date_of_birth": "2000-01-01"
12 },
13 "dependent": {
14 "first_name": "Jordan",
15 "last_name": "Doe",
16 "date_of_birth": "2001-07-14"
17 },
18 "encounter": {
19 "service_type_codes": [
20 "30"
21 ]
22 }
23}
Aetna with subscriber only
1{
2 "payer_id": "60054",
3 "provider": {
4 "organization_name": "Provider Name",
5 "npi": "1999999984"
6 },
7 "subscriber": {
8 "first_name": "Jane",
9 "last_name": "Doe",
10 "date_of_birth": "2004-04-04",
11 "member_id": "AETNA12345"
12 },
13 "encounter": {
14 "service_type_codes": [
15 "30"
16 ]
17 }
18}
Aaa 42 payer unreachable
1{
2 "payer_id": "87726",
3 "provider": {
4 "organization_name": "Medical Provider",
5 "npi": "1999999984"
6 },
7 "subscriber": {
8 "first_name": "Jane",
9 "last_name": "Doe",
10 "date_of_birth": "2001-01-01",
11 "member_id": "UHCAAA42"
12 },
13 "encounter": {
14 "service_type_codes": [
15 "30"
16 ]
17 }
18}
Aaa 43 invalid missing provider id
1{
2 "payer_id": "87726",
3 "provider": {
4 "organization_name": "Medical Provider",
5 "npi": "1999999984"
6 },
7 "subscriber": {
8 "first_name": "Jane",
9 "last_name": "Doe",
10 "date_of_birth": "1970-01-01",
11 "member_id": "UHCAAA43"
12 },
13 "encounter": {
14 "service_type_codes": [
15 "30"
16 ]
17 }
18}
Aaa 72 invalid missing subscriber insured id
1{
2 "payer_id": "87726",
3 "provider": {
4 "organization_name": "Medical Provider",
5 "npi": "1999999984"
6 },
7 "subscriber": {
8 "first_name": "John",
9 "last_name": "Doe",
10 "date_of_birth": "1990-01-01",
11 "member_id": "UHCAAA72"
12 },
13 "encounter": {
14 "service_type_codes": [
15 "30"
16 ]
17 }
18}
Aaa 73 invalid missing subscriber insured name
1{
2 "payer_id": "87726",
3 "provider": {
4 "organization_name": "Medical Provider",
5 "npi": "1999999984"
6 },
7 "subscriber": {
8 "first_name": "John",
9 "last_name": "Doe",
10 "date_of_birth": "1990-01-01",
11 "member_id": "UHCAAA73"
12 },
13 "encounter": {
14 "service_type_codes": [
15 "30"
16 ]
17 }
18}
Aaa 75 subscriber insured not found
1{
2 "payer_id": "87726",
3 "provider": {
4 "organization_name": "Medical Provider",
5 "npi": "1999999984"
6 },
7 "subscriber": {
8 "first_name": "Jane",
9 "last_name": "Doe",
10 "date_of_birth": "1990-01-01",
11 "member_id": "UHCAAA75"
12 },
13 "encounter": {
14 "service_type_codes": [
15 "30"
16 ]
17 }
18}
Aaa 79 invalid participant id
1{
2 "payer_id": "87726",
3 "provider": {
4 "organization_name": "Medical Provider",
5 "npi": "1999999984"
6 },
7 "subscriber": {
8 "first_name": "John",
9 "last_name": "Doe",
10 "date_of_birth": "1970-01-01",
11 "member_id": "UHCAAA79"
12 },
13 "encounter": {
14 "service_type_codes": [
15 "30"
16 ]
17 }
18}